Bring your brightest version of you and have a brighter work day here.About the TeamThe Service Discovery team mission is to provide a world-class Service Discovery, and Distributed services coordination solution for our customers. Our mission is to deliver a world-class Service Discovery solution that supports secure, scalable and highly available distributed systems. We are seeking candidates with a keen interest in developing innovative distributed systems solutions at scale.These critical solutions underpin the foundational layers of the Workday stack, ensuring optimal performance across both Private Data Centers and Public Cloud environments such as AWS and GCP.About the RoleWe are looking for SRE candidates skilled in solving distributed systems design and deployment challenges, while driving automation for secure, scalable, and self-healing systems. A Senior SRE in our team should have a solid background in Infrastructure as Code, deploying JVM applications using Chef and Kubernetes. They will have the opportunity to work in an evolving micro services environment where resilience, performance and security are key requirements. Responsibilities:Design, deploy, and tune critical infrastructure for distributed applications, focusing on automation, high availability, scalability, and self-healing capabilities.Engage in the development and maintenance of Restful services, service-oriented architecture, distributed systems, cloud systems, and microservices.Utilize configuration management tools like Chef.Work with containerization technologies such as Docker and orchestration frameworks like Kubernetes.Contribute to the observability, monitoring, and alerting frameworks to ensure industry best practices are implemented.Conduct performance analysis and optimization for distributed systems to ensure efficient resource use and swift response times.Design runbooks and codify remediation flows for systematic issue resolution.Troubleshoot and resolve issues within distributed systems.Lead and coordinate teams for larger projects to ensure timely delivery.Collaborate effectively within a world-class engineering teamAbout YouBasic QualificationsBachelor's or higher degree in Computer Science or a related field.5+ years of commercial SRE experienceExcellent communication and teamwork / collaboration ability.Experience with continuous integrations and deployment using Jenkins, Bamboo, or similarSignificant experience with configuration management tools such as ChefSignificant experience with containerization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es, Helm ) AWSProficiency in Python, Ruby, or similar scripting languages, along with Linux system scripting.Strong analytical and troubleshooting skills, especially in distributed systems environments. Preferred QualificationsFamiliarity with Apache ZooKeeper, Consul, Eureka, or similar technologies is a plus.Familiarity with Go language is a plus.Our Approach to Flexible Work With Flex Work, we’re combining the best of both worlds: in-person time and remote.
